Genshin Impression, Rocket League, Honkai: Star Rail, Grand Theft Auto 5, and Fortnite had been the highest 5 video games — “by participant spend and engagement,” per Epic Video games — on the Epic Video games Retailer in 2024. None of these 5 video games had been launched in 2024. Epic Games released its Year in Review blog on Friday, the place it introduced the platform had 32 million every day lively customers (from a complete of 295 million Home windows PC gamers) throughout all its video games.
The highest video games in 2024 are damaged into three classes: 5 video games listed as Mythic, 5 as Legendary, and 10 as Epic. It might not shock you that the highest 5 video games are all free-to-play, besides Grand Theft Auto 5, which has bought greater than 210 million copies. An Epic Video games consultant informed Polygon “titles inside every tier are randomized, not in any order of these metrics” of spending and engagement. EA Sports activities FC 24, Future 2, Alan Wake 2, Fall Guys, and Wuthering Waves are the 5 listed as Legendary. EA Sports activities FC 25, Cyberpunk 2077, The Sims 4, Black Fable: Wukong, Passable, Warframe, Farming Simulator 2022, Useless by Daylight, Purple Useless Redemption 2, and Useless Island 2 are the ten video games listed as Epic.
Of those 20 video games, simply 4 video games had been launched in 2024. Whereas it may be stunning to see laid out so clearly, the “black gap” of older video games overriding new ones has been ongoing for a number of years. In 2023, games six years old or more took up 61% of people’s gaming time, in accordance with Newzoo. As Ryan Rigney put it in his Push to Talk newsletter, “in 2023 simply 5 video games, most of them launched over a decade in the past, collectively accounted for extra playtime than each recreation launched in 2022 and 2023 mixed.”
That left 23% of recreation time for brand spanking new video games — however of these new video games, nearly all of that enjoying time goes towards annualized releases like Name of Obligation or sports activities video games. Eight p.c of enjoying time in 2023 went towards new video games untethered from huge, annual IP. Analyst and The Metaverse author Matthew Ball wrote in his State of Video Gaming in 2025 presentation that the identical 5 franchises — Name of Obligation, Counter-Strike, Fortnite, League of Legends, and Minecraft — has averaged 30% of playtime for 4 years operating on Home windows PC; on console, the highest 5 franchises — Name of Obligation, FIFA/EA FC, Fortnite, Grand Theft Auto, and NBA 2K — have averaged 43% of all playtime for 4 years straight.
Individuals are enjoying new video games, however not almost as a lot as they’re enjoying older, lengthy operating ones.
